Person-Centered Therapy
A form of psychotherapy developed by Carl Rogers that emphasizes the importance of being in a conducive environment that provides congruence, unconditional positive regard, and empathic understanding to help individuals realize their true self.
Positive Self-Regard
Positive self-regard is the condition of holding oneself in high esteem and acknowledging one's own worth and capabilities in a healthy manner.
Conditional Positive Regard
A situation where acceptance and love are provided only when an individual behaves in a manner that is approved by others, leading to conditions of worth.
